Step-by-step Preparation for Crispy and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ies
Making crispy and chewy chocolate chip cookies is less about the perfection of each step and more about enjoying the process. Let’s break down this delightful experience step-by-step like a friendly mentor guiding you through a cozy kitchen.
Gather Your Ingredients
Before you dive into baking, take a moment to gather all your ingredients.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 3/4 cup packed brown s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
Having everything ready not only streamlines your baking but also makes the experience feel more enjoyable. As you measure, consider experimenting with different types of chocolate chips, such as dark or white chocolate, to find your preferred flavor combination.
Preheat the Oven and Prepare the Baking Sheet
Set your oven to preheat at 350°F (175°C). Preheating your oven ensures that your cookies bake evenly from the moment they go in. While that warms up, line your baking sheet with parchment paper or a silpat mat. This small touch prevents sticking and promotes even browning.
Cream Together Butter and Sugars
In a mixing bowl, combine your softened butter with the granulated and brown sugars. Use a hand mixer or a stand mixer to cream them together until the mixture is light and fluffy—about 2-3 minutes. This step creates air pockets in the dough that will lead to a better texture in your crispy and chewy chocolate chip cookies.
Add in the Eggs and Vanilla Extract
Next, crack in the eggs one at a time, ensuring each one is fully incorporated before adding the next. Pour in the vanilla extract, mixing until well combined. The vanilla enhances the overall flavor of your cookies, adding a warm, comforting aroma that invites you to indulge.
Mix the Dry Ingredients Separately
In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. This step is crucial—it ensures that your baking soda is evenly distributed, allowing for consistent rising. By mixing dry ingredients separately, you minimize the chance of clumping, making for an even better cookie dough.
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ients
Now, it’s time to merge worlds! Gradually add the dry ingredients to your buttery mixture, mixing on low speed just until combined. Overmixing at this stage can lead to denser cookies, and we want them to be delightfully crispy and chewy.
Fold in Chocolate Chips
Gently fold in the chocolate chips using a spatula. This is where the magic truly happens; the warm, melted chocolate will create gooey pockets in each cookie, making every bite a little piece of heaven. Consider adding nuts or dried fruit for an extra crunch or chew.
Scoop and Shape the Cookie Dough
Use a cookie scoop or spoon to portion out your dough onto the prepared baking sheet. Leave about 2 inches between each scoop, as they will spread while baking. If you’re feeling fancy, you can gently reshape the tops with your hands for a more polished look.
Bake Until Golden Brown
Now, it’s time for the big moment! Place the baking sheet in the oven and b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own but the centers are still soft. This will ensure that you maintain that delightful crispy exterior while holding onto chewy goodness inside. Keep an eye on them, as every oven is slightly different!
Once out of the oven, let them cool for a few minutes on the baking sheet before transferring them to a wire rack. Cooking Tips and Notes for Crispy and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ies
Tips for achieving the perfect texture
To create crispy and chewy chocolate chip cookies, begin by chilling your cookie dough for at least 30 minutes. This enhances the flavor and helps control spread during baking. Use a mix of brown and granulated sugars; the brown sugar contributes moisture, leading to that delightful chewiness. Additionally, don’t overmix your dough; fold in the chocolate chips just until incorporated to maintain texture.
Common pitfalls to avoid
One common mistake is baking at too high a temperature, leading to burnt edges before the center is fully cooked. Stick to a moderate heat, usually around 350°F (175°C). Also, be cautious with portion sizes—if the cookies are too large, they won’t cook evenly. Lastly, always check for browning; the cookies should be slightly golden at the edges but still soft in the center, giving you that perfect bite.

FAQs about Crispy and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ies
Can I freeze the cookie dough?
Absolutely! Freezing your cookie dough is a fantastic way to have fresh crispy and chewy chocolate chip cookies on hand whenever you crave them. Simply scoop the dough into tablespoon-sized balls and place them on a baking sheet. Freeze until firm, then transfer them to an airtight container or a resealable plastic bag. They’ll keep in the freezer for up to three months. When you’re ready to bake, no need to thaw; just add a couple of extra minutes to the baking time.
What type of chocolate is best for these cookies?
The type of chocolate you use can make all the difference in flavor. For crispy and chewy chocolate chip cookies, consider using a mix of semi-sweet chocolate chips and dark chocolate chunks. The semi-sweet provides a balanced sweetness, while dark chocolate intensifies the flavor. If you’re feeling adventurous, try adding some milk chocolate or even butterscotch chips for a unique twist. Brands like Guittard or Ghirardelli are widely recommended for their rich taste—check them out for some exceptional quality options.
How can I adjust the recipe for gluten-free options?
No problem! Making your crispy and chewy chocolate chip cookies gluten-free is very doable. Simply swap all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end that includes xanthan gum—this will help mimic the chewiness of traditional wheat flour. Brands like Bob’s Red Mill or King Arthur Flour have reliable blends that work well in baking. Be sure to check labels to ensure all other ingredients are gluten-free as well. PrintCrispy and Chewy Chocolate Chip Cookies: The Best Homemade Treat
Enjoy the perfect balance of crispy and chewy with these delicious chocolate chip cookies!
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 10 minutes
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: 24 cookies 1x
- Category: Desserts
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Ingredients
- 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 3/4 cup packed br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 large eggs
- 2 cups semisweet chocolate chips
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a small bowl, mix together the flour, baking soda, and salt.
- In a large bowl, beat the softened butter, granulated sugar, brown sugar, and vanilla extract until creamy.
-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.
- Gradually add the flour mixture to the butter mixture, blending until combined.
- Stir in the chocolate chips.
- Drop by rounded tablespoon on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ake for 9 to 11 minutes or until golden brown.
- Cool on ba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to wire racks to cool completely.
Notes
- For chewier cookies, do not overbake.
- Make sure your ingredients are at room temperature for the best results.
